一种控制响应方法及智能电子设备的制造方法

文档序号:9742680阅读:349来源:国知局
一种控制响应方法及智能电子设备的制造方法
【技术领域】
[0001]本发明涉及信息处理技术领域,特别涉及一种控制响应方法及智能电子设备。
【背景技术】
[0002]目前,使用智能电子设备的用户越来越多,智能电子设备包括一固定的触摸屏,用户可以在该触摸屏上进行各种操作,如对触摸屏上所显示的电子地图进行放大或缩小。
[0003]其中智能电子设备可以采用如下两种方式对电子设备进行放大或缩小,第一种方式是:触摸屏在显示“地图”应用的同时,还会显示与“地图”应用相关的操作按钮,如采用加号按钮表示放大操作,减号按钮表示缩小操作。当操作体在触摸屏上执行点击操作时,智能电子设备通过触摸屏可以获取当前点击操作的点击位置,并将该点击位置与操作按钮的显示位置进行比对,根据比对结果确定出点击操作对应的操作按钮,生成与操作按钮相对应的指令,这样当电子设备执行指令时即可完成对当前所处位置的区域的放大或缩小。
[0004]第二种方式是:通过检测用户的两个手指在触摸屏上滑动时的距离变化情况生成相应的指令,具体是当距离变化情况为由小到大时生成放大指令来放大当前所处位置的区域;当距离变化情况为由大到小时生成缩小指令来缩小当前所处位置的区域。

【发明内容】

[0005]有鉴于此,本发明实施例提供一种控制响应方法及智能电子设备,通过操作智能电子设备中可活动的输入装置,触发智能电子设备响应执行指令。为实现该技术效果,本发明实施例提供的控制响应方法及智能电子设备的技术方案如下:
[0006]本发明实施例提供一种控制响应方法,所述方法应用于智能电子设备中,所述方法包括:
[0007]获得操作体针对所述智能电子设备的输入装置的第一操作,所述输入装置与所述智能电子设备的显示屏幕对应;
[0008]根据所述第一操作确定所述第一操作的输入位置;
[0009]在所述第一操作的输入位置维持不变的情况下,获得所述智能电子设备的输入装置相对于所述智能电子设备运动的运动参数,其中,所述智能电子设备的输入装置相对于所述智能电子设备至少支持一维运动;
[0010]基于输入位置和所述运动参数确定并响应执行指令;其中,所述运动参数不同对应的执行指令不同。
[0011]优选地,基于输入位置和所述运动参数确定执行指令包括:
[0012]在所述智能电子设备的输入装置相对于所述智能电子设备运动过程中,当所述输入位置存在且所述输入位置不变时,根据所述运动参数确定执行指令。
[0013]优选地,所述输入装置为触摸显示屏,所述触摸显示屏包括触摸感应层和所述显示屏幕,所述触摸感应层中的感应单元与所述显示屏幕中的显示单元对应;
[0014]所述获得操作体针对所述智能电子设备的输入装置的第一操作之前,所述方法还包括:控制在所述触摸显示屏上显示第一显示界面;
[0015]所述基于输入位置和所述运动参数确定并响应执行指令包括:
[0016]基于所述输入位置确定所述第一显示界面中的第一显示位置;
[0017]当所述输入位置存在且所述输入位置不变,所述运动参数为第一运动参数时,产生放大指令;
[0018]以所述第一显示位置为中心针对所述第一显示界面执行所述放大指令;
[0019]或者
[0020]基于所述输入位置确定所述第一显示界面中的第一显示位置;
[0021]当所述输入位置存在且所述输入位置不变,所述运动参数为第二运动参数时,产生缩小指令;
[0022]以所述第一显示位置为中心针对所述第一显示界面执行所述缩小指令。
[0023]优选地,所述方法还包括:当所述输入位置存在且所述输入位置不变并持续获得运动参数时,获取持续时间,并根据持续时间确定响应倍数。
[0024]优选地,所述方法还包括:控制所述显示屏幕显示第二显示界面,所述第二显示界面内包括M个显示对象,M为大于等于I的整数,所述输入装置的输入单元与所述显示屏幕的显示单元对应;
[0025]所述基于输入位置和所述运动参数确定并响应执行指令包括:
[0026]基于所述输入位置确定所述第二显示界面中的第二显示位置;
[0027]当所述输入位置存在且所述输入位置不变时,根据所述运动参数确定执行指令;
[0028]基于所述第二显示位置响应所述执行指令。
[0029]优选地,所述基于所述第二显示位置响应所述执行指令包括:
[0030]确定所述第二显示位置在所述第二显示界面上对应的第一显示对象;
[0031]根据所述智能电子设备的输入装置相对于所述智能电子设备运动的运动方向,产生与所述运动方向对应的移动指令;
[0032]响应所述移动指令,所述移动指令用于基于所述运动方向改变所述第一显示对象和第二显示界面的相对位置;
[0033]或者,
[0034]所述基于所述第二显示位置响应所述执行指令包括:
[0035]基于所述第二显示位置以及根据所述智能电子设备的输入装置相对于所述智能电子设备运动的运动方向,产生与所述运动方向对应的显示对象选择指令;
[0036]响应所述显示对象选择指令,所述显示对象选择指令用于从所述第二显示位置开始到所述智能电子设备的输入装置相对于所述智能电子设备运动结束时选择多个显示对象。
[0037]本发明实施例还提供一种智能电子设备,包括控制响应装置和位于所述智能电子设备上且可活动的输入装置,所述控制响应装置包括:
[0038]第一获取单元,用于获得操作体针对所述智能电子设备的输入装置的第一操作,所述输入装置与所述智能电子设备的显示屏幕对应;
[0039]第一确定单元,用于根据所述第一操作确定所述第一操作的输入位置;
[0040]第二获取单元,用于在所述第一操作的输入位置维持不变的情况下,获得所述智能电子设备的输入装置相对于所述智能电子设备运动的运动参数,其中,所述智能电子设备的输入装置相对于所述智能电子设备至少支持一维运动;
[0041]第二确定单元,用于基于输入位置和所述运动参数确定,其中,所述运动参数不同对应的执行指令不同;
[0042]响应单元,用于响应执行指令。
[0043]优选地,所述第二确定单元基于输入位置和所述运动参数确定执行指令包括:在所述智能电子设备的输入智能电子设备相对于所述智能电子设备运动过程中,当所述输入位置存在且所述输入位置不变时,根据所述运动参数确定执行指令。
[0044]优选地,所述输入装置为触摸显示屏,所述触摸显示屏包括触摸感应层和所述显示屏幕,所述触摸感应层中的感应单元与所述显示屏幕中的显示单元对应;
[0045]所述智能电子设备还包括:控制装置,用于控制在所述触摸显示屏上显示第一显示界面;
[0046]所述第二确定单元包括:第一确定子单元和第一指令产生子单元;
[0047]所述第一确定子单元,用于基于所述输入位置确定所述第一显示界面中的第一显示位置;
[0048]所述第一指令产生子单元,用于当所述输入位置存在且所述输入位置不变,所述运动参数为第一运动参数时,产生放大指令,并触发所述响应单元以所述第一显示位置为中心针对所述第一显示界面执行所述放大指令;
[0049]或者
[0050]所述第二确定单元包括:第二确定子单元和第二指令产生子单元;
[0051]所述第二确定子单元,用于基于所述输入位置确定所述第一显示界面中的第一显示位置;
[0052]所述第二指令产生子单元,用于当所述输入位置存在且所述输入位置不变,所述运动参数为第二运动参数时,产生缩小指令,并触发所述响应单元以所述第一显示位置为中心针对所述第一显示界面执行所述缩小指令。
[0053]优选地,所述控制响应装置还包括:第三获取单元,用于当所述输入位置存在且所述输入位置不变并持续获得运动参数时,获取持续时间,并根据持续时间确定响应倍数。
[0054]优选地,所述智能电子设备还包括:显示控制装置,用于控制所述显示屏幕显示第二显示界面,所述第二显示界面内包括M个显示对象,M为大于等于I的整数,所述输入智能电子设备的输入单元与所述显示屏幕的显示单元对应;
[0055]所述第二确定单元包括:位置确定子单元和指令确定子单元;
[0056]所述位置确定子单元,用于基于所述输入位置确定所述第二显示界面中的第二显示位置;
[0057]所述指令确定子单元,用于当所述输入位置存在且所述输入位置不变时,根据所述运动参数确定执行指令,并触发所述响应单元基于所述第二显示位置响应所述执行指令。
[0058]优选地,所述响应单元包括:对象确定子单元、第三指令产生子单元和第一响应子单元;
[0059]所述对象确定子单元,用于确定所述第二显示位置在所述第二显示界面上对应的第一显示对象;
[0060]所述第三指令产生子单元,用于根据所述智能电子设备的输入智能电子设备相对于所述智能电子设备运动的运动方向,产生与所述运动方向对应的移动指令;
[0061]所述第一响应子单元,用于响应所述移动指令,所述移动指令用于基于所述运动方向改变所述第一显示对象和第二显示界面的相对位置;
[0062]或者,
[0063]所述响应单元包括:第四指令产生子单元和第二响应子单元;
[0064]所述第四指令产生子单元,用于基于所述第二显示位置以及根据所述智能电子设备的输入智能电子设备相对于所述智能电子设备运动的运动方向,产生与所述运动方向对应的显示对象选择指令;
[0065]所述第二响应子单元,用于响应所述显示对象选择指令,所述显示对象选择指令用于从所述第二显示位置开始到所述智能电子设备的输入智能电子设备相对于所述智能电子设备运动结束时选择多个显示对象。
[0066]上述本发明实施例提供的控制响应方法及智能电子设备,可以通过操作智能电子设备中可活动的输入装置,获取对输入装置进行第一操作时的输入位置和在输入位置维持不变的情况下输入装置相对于智能电子设备运动的运动参数,再基于输入位置和运动参数确定并响应执行指令。由此可知,本发明实施例在智能电子设备中设置有可活动的输入装置的前提下,以对可活动的输入装置的操作代替现有智能电子设备中对固定触摸屏的操作,通过针对可活动的输入装置的第一操作实现执行指令的确定及响应。
【附图说明】
[0067]为了更清楚地说明本发明实施例中的技术方案,下面将对实施例描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动性的前提下,还可以根据这些附图获得其他的附图。
[0068]图1为本发明实施例提供的控制响应方法的第一种流程图;
[0069]图2为本发明实施例提供的控制响应方法的第二种流程图;
[0070]图3为本发明实施例提供的智能电子设备的一种状态图;
[0071]图4为本发明实施例提供的智能电子设备的另一种状态图;
[0072]图5为本发明实施例提供的控制响应方法的第三种流程图;
[00
当前第1页1 2 3 4 5 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1